Transaction befb950a148aff1282132c910859b3e648499333ee376bae31f91cfc2f5185d6
1 Input
1 Output
-
befb950a148aff1282132c910859b3e648499333ee376bae31f91cfc2f5185d6:0
- value
- 9589100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c5c41ebf7e0c66692e24606686644d3b599dede OP_EQUAL
- address
- 3LKaHqjkn5YN5i3DLNyL9aev8RYeQupK1E